Output 6b42419c75a78b64fcf20c985921d420a1843d3054d09fe4f5e00c731b7dbeb1:0

value
51424743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0c91d87842317e7490ba32fd18843eb26bf899 OP_EQUAL
address
MPmSsAfNVnsXsaHzzAXF8TU4aTi1boht4B
transaction
6b42419c75a78b64fcf20c985921d420a1843d3054d09fe4f5e00c731b7dbeb1
spent
true